Friend of the show, Matt Moberg, returns to talk with current Bethany Lutheran College student, Natalie Hennig. In this host-less episode, the two have a peaceful talk about what inspires their music, their music experience, and how music makes them feel. Plus! A bonus feature of their majestic singing voices to serenade all of you readers out there!

Pathos - the appeal to emotion, means to persuade an audience by purposely evoking certain emotions to make them feel the way the author wants them to feel. Writers can desire a range of emotional responses, including sympathy, anger, frustration, or even amusement.
